How much does it cost to rent an apartment in University of Oregon Campus?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
University of Oregon Campus Studio Apartments | $1,620 | $1,000 | $4,329 |
University of Oregon Campus 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,922 | $625 | $5,726 |
University of Oregon Campus 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,585 | $670 | $5,401 |
University of Oregon Campus 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,380 | $619 | $3,537 |
University of Oregon Campus 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,046 | $625 | $3,950 |
University of Oregon Campus 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,922 | $1,129 | $5,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Student University of Oregon Campus Apartments
What is the Cheapest Student apartment in University of Oregon Campus?
Currently the most affordable Student Apartment in University of Oregon Campus is at Stadium Park listed at $609.
How much is the average rent for a Student University of Oregon Campus Apartment?
The average rent for a Student Apartment in University of Oregon Campus is $1,357.
What is the largest Student University of Oregon Campus Apartment for rent?
Today's Student apartment with the most square footage in University of Oregon Campus is a 1,688 square feet unit starting from $1,089 at The Rive Eugene.
What is the average size for University of Oregon Campus Student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Student rental in University of Oregon Campus is currently at 476 sq ft.
